Arsenal have reportedly made an offer to sign Brentford captain Christian Nørgaard this summer.
The 31-year-old midfielder has recently been linked with a potential move to the Emirates.
Now, a major update has emerged regarding Nørgaard's future.
According to Danish outlet Bold, Arsenal have submitted an official proposal to Brentford for the Denmark international.
The report from Denmark has since been backed by multiple reliable sources.
The Athletic's David Ornstein claims the Gunners have tabled a €11m bid for Nørgaard, with the club now awaiting a response from Brentford.
Meanwhile, transfer experts Fabrizio Romano and Foot Mercato's Santi Aouna both report that Brentford are demanding a higher fee, with negotiations between the two clubs still ongoing.
Nørgaard is believed to be keen on joining Arsenal this summer.
